Lukebakio hands Benfica a timely boost before Alverca

Article image:Lukebakio hands Benfica a timely boost before Alverca

Dodi Lukebakio has rejoined Benfica training as José Mourinho’s side prepare to host Alverca.

According to A Bola, the 29-year-old winger is back almost three months after fracturing his ankle on Belgium duty in November.

He has been fully reintegrated without obvious limitations, although it remains highly unlikely he will be selected for Sunday, 8 February.

The No 11 now enters the next phase of his recovery, focused on regaining previous fitness levels.

Preparations featured gym work before the squad moved out onto the pitch, with Enzo Barrenechea also edging closer to full fitness.

This season Lukebakio has 11 appearances for Benfica, six in the Liga Portugal Betclic, three in the Champions League, one in the Taça de Portugal and one in the Taça da Liga.

Across 835 minutes he has scored one goal and provided three assists, and is valued at 20 million euros.
